- Fixed potential undefined behavior in `Signal::try_from` on some platforms.
(#[1484](https://github.com/nix-rust/nix/pull/1484))
- Fixed buffer overflow in `unistd::getgrouplist`.
(#[1545](https://github.com/nix-rust/nix/pull/1545))
